The vaccination lottery is to be another tool of the government to persuade people to be vaccinated against COVID-19. We do not know if he will be successful. The lottery met with a number of supporters, but also opponents. She did not avoid controversy either, you will certainly remember Mrs. Zuzana, who could have won 400 thousand euros, but due to a delayed internet signal, she could not read the password in time to ensure her win.

More than 10,000 vaccinated people have already won the vaccination lottery. Every vaccinee can check if they belong directly to them on the website of the Ministry of Finance of the Slovak Republic. Winnings can be verified by several filters, such as name, municipality, code or winning amount. After the status of Igor Matovič, which he published on the social network Facebook, the site probably experienced a great onslaught, which it could not handle and fell. It works without problems at the moment.

The problem is that finding winners is impractical and time-consuming. It is always necessary to enter the competition 9-digit code, the page does not remember it. Those who were vaccinated with the single-dose vaccine received one code, and those vaccinated with the two-dose vaccine have two codes.

Programmer Jakub Bajzath has created a simple page that will greatly simplify the verification of the win. You only need to enter the competition code once on one device, it is also possible to enter more than one code at a time. The browser remembers the codes and it is possible to verify more than one code at a time. This is ideal when the whole family is competing. The website www.vyhralsom.sk thus shows that it is also easier and more convenient.

Why did you decide to create the vyhralsom.sk website?

My own need led me to create a website. I wanted to verify several codes in the vaccine lottery, but I found it annoying to enter all the codes into the filter and especially to enter them there every time I want to verify the win. So I started looking for whether the Ministry offers a source from which I could obtain this data and then compare it with the codes entered by the user. And since they had such a source, at the same moment I bought the domain vyhralsom.sk and started working on the web.

How long did it take you to create a website?

In total, it took about an hour to create a site with the purchase of a domain and connection. Then I made a lot of minor adjustments, but it was already running a sharp production version on the domain vyhralsom.sk. The web as such is not really complicated at all. Due to the fact that it is not connected to databases or even storing data, its creation was really fast. At first I didn’t look at graphics, UX / UI or SEO. I made the site quickly so I could verify the codes and then I tested a lot. I posted the page in a few groups and people caught on. I dare say that because it is fast and carefree. People today simply don’t have the time and need to do things in a few clicks if possible. And I made it possible for them. After a few hours, I started working on the mobile version and gradually I redesigned the whole design to a nicer and clearer one, so that even the UX experience was higher.

How does it all work?

As I mentioned, all functionality is based on two things. The first is the verification of codes against the database of the Ministry of Finance, which is publicly available. If the code is in this database, the database mediates the code itself, the name of the winner, the municipality / city and the amount of the prize. This data will then be displayed in a verification table on the vyhralsom.sk website. Thanks to that, you don’t have to look for who, for example, the code belongs to in the family. You can find out on the web quite easily and quickly.

Since we are a portal about Android, do you also develop applications for Android?

I developed hybrid applications, ie for iOS and Android. I always try to bring applications that are missing on the market and can be beneficial. It is often because I miss such an apka and when I miss it, there is a chance that I miss others. My first was the FIŠTA application, which was actually such a “mobile Finstat”. However, this project fell over time because the data that was needed from Finstat was constantly changing, so the development was too demanding for the pro-bono project. In short, there was no time for that. The latest application, which is only for Android, is Scrabble Dictionary. Since my wife and I play Scrabble and always argue about whether a word exists or not, I created this application that selects the words you are looking for from several dictionaries and then offers their meaning. We haven’t argued about Scrabble since 🙂 A similar alternative for iOS already existed, so I only published the application on Google Play and Huawei AppGallery. I’m planning another application, it’s about the weather, but it’s still early to talk about it.
